AN ACT
AN ACT
To
amend Code Section 27-4-133 of the Official Code of Georgia Annotated, relating
to certain regulation of the taking of shrimp, so as to change provisions
relating to the opening of certain waters for commercial shrimping under certain
conditions; to provide for related matters; to repeal conflicting laws; and for
other purposes.
BE
IT ENACTED BY THE GENERAL ASSEMBLY OF GEORGIA:
SECTION
1.
Code
Section 27-4-133 of the Official Code of Georgia Annotated, relating to certain
regulation of the taking of shrimp, is amended by revising subsection (a) as
follows:
"(a)
Except as otherwise specifically provided, it shall be unlawful for any person
to use a power-drawn net in any of the salt waters of this state for commercial
shrimping for human consumption. All sounds shall be closed to such
fishing,
except that the commissioner may open Cumberland, St. Simons, Sapelo, St.
Andrew, Wassaw, or Ossabaw sounds or any combination of such sounds at any time
between September 1 and December 31, provided that he or she has determined that
the shrimp in the waters of each sound to be opened are 45 or fewer shrimp with
heads on to the pound; and the commissioner shall close each sound so opened
when he or she has determined that the shrimp in the waters of the sound exceed
45 shrimp with heads on to the pound. The
commissioner may open any waters outside, on the seaward side, of the sounds
between May 15 and December 31, provided that he or she has determined that the
shrimp in such outside waters are 45 or fewer shrimp with heads on to the pound;
and the commissioner shall close the waters so opened when he or she has
determined that the shrimp in such outside waters exceed 45 shrimp with heads on
to the pound. The commissioner may open any waters outside the sounds during the
months of January and February, provided that he or she has determined that the
shrimp in such outside waters are 50 or fewer shrimp with heads on to the pound;
and the commissioner shall close such outside waters so opened when he or she
has determined that the shrimp in such outside waters exceed 50 shrimp with
heads on to the pound. The department shall conduct inspections for such shrimp
count, and a determination by the commissioner shall be conclusive as to the
count. The commissioner shall provide public notice of the opening and closing
of such waters, as provided in this Code section, by posting a notice of all
openings and closings at the courthouse and on all shrimp docks and by such
other means as may appear feasible. The notices shall be posted at least 24
hours prior to any change in the opening and closing of any such waters,
provided that such notice is required only when waters are opened or closed by
action of the commissioner."
